A novel in six parts, set in six different timelines, written in six different prose styles, participating in six distinct genres ranging from 19thcentury travel journal to postapocalyptic science fiction, cloud atlas interrupts each of its narrativesexcept the central storyin. Published in 2004, the fantastical speculative fiction book consists of six interconnected nested stories that take the reader from the remote south pacific in the nineteenth century to the island of hawaii in a distant postapocalyptic future. Cloud atlas begins in 1850 with adam ewing, an american notary voyaging from the chatham isles to his home in california.
